Getting Hooked on Oblivion Remastered – My Alchemy Adventure Begins

Lately, I’ve been diving headfirst into The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ion Remastered, and honestly? I’m completely hooked.

As someone who spends a lot of time in Azeroth healing dungeons as a resto druid in WoW Classic Cataclysm, Oblivion has been a refreshing escape — chaotic in the best way, filled with quirky NPCs, nostalgic graphics (with a glow-up), and endless opportunities to mess around in Tamriel. But my favorite part so far?

Becoming a potion-making, money-stacking alchemy queen.

No joke, I’ve been grinding herbs like it’s my job. Every time I venture out of a city, I’m zig-zagging through the wilderness picking mushrooms, flowers, and whatever else I can find. If it glows, grows, or looks vaguely suspicious — it’s in my inventory.

There’s something super satisfying about finding rare ingredients, heading back to my mortar and pestle setup, and crafting potions that turn into gold at the nearest shop. I started out broke and wandering around in ragged robes, and now I’m rolling in septims and rocking enchanted gear like I own the Arcane University.

Sure, the Oblivion Remaster still has its fair share of classic jank — guards with spider-senses, people yelling “STOP RIGHT THERE, CRIMINAL SCUM,” and that weird potato face lighting — but that’s part of the charm. And with all the improvements to textures, lighting, and performance, it feels like revisiting a beloved classic with a fresh coat of paint.

If you’ve ever played Oblivion before and want to relive the magic — or if you’ve never played it at all — now’s the perfect time to jump in and get lost in the chaos. Just don’t blame me when you spend three hours harvesting plants instead of doing the main quest.
